Checklist item — off-site contract run (receiving site, Dunhallow office). Confirm the sealed folder of signed Ambervale contracts arrives with seal intact and matches the transfer sheet. Sign and time-stamp the acceptance log, then place the folder directly in the records safe, not the mail tray. Notify Mr. Calloway once secured. The confidential courier hand-over instruction is appended directly beneath this item.

handover note for kajep-bajof: the sorius jorix courier leaves the tamion ledger at gate 1956 under passcode 064069

**Ticket: Config drift on BounceSift processor**

The email bounce processor in the Larkfield environment has drifted from the values committed in the release branch. Retry windows and suppression thresholds no longer match, which likely explains the duplicate suppression entries reported Tuesday. Please reconcile before the Thursday cut. For reference, the currently deployed configuration on the live node reads as follows.

config for yajep-yahof:
[briax]
port = 9200
region = outer-2
host = briax.nelvrocorp.test
team = raleth
timeout_ms = 1500
retries = 1

Leadership Review Briefing — Concentration Risk

For the finance team: Dornel Fabrication accounts for 38% of Seabright Components' revenue this year, up from 29%. Contract renewal is due in Q2 and pricing pressure is expected. We are modelling downside scenarios and pursuing two new accounts in the Marrow Valley corridor. The confidential plan summary follows below.

board note of fahif-yahog: Gross margin on Wenath came in at 10 percent against a plan of 5 percent. Only 3 of the 100 pilot accounts renewed Wenath, so a churn review is set for July 15.